Choosing the Right Colors

When selecting tights to mix and match for unique looks, ensure the colors complement each other well to create a cohesive and stylish outfit. Start by choosing a base color that matches the dominant color in your outfit. For example, if you're wearing a navy dress, opt for tights in a similar shade to tie the look together seamlessly. If you want to add a pop of color, consider selecting tights in a complementary hue, such as burgundy with a forest green dress for a sophisticated contrast.

Experiment with different shades of the same color for a monochromatic look that elongates your legs. Darker tights paired with lighter-colored shoes can create an interesting visual effect, drawing attention to your footwear. Remember that neutral tights in black, gray, or nude are versatile options that can be paired with almost any outfit for a classic and timeless appeal.

Playing With Patterns

To elevate your tights game and create standout ensembles, consider incorporating various patterns that add a touch of flair and personality to your overall look. Mixing patterns can be a fun and stylish way to express your unique fashion sense.

Start by choosing one statement patterned piece, like polka dots or stripes, and pair it with a more subtle pattern, such as floral or geometric designs. This contrast will create visual interest and make your outfit pop.

When mixing patterns, pay attention to the scale of the prints. If you're wearing a bold, large-scale pattern, balance it out with a smaller, more delicate pattern to avoid overwhelming your look. Additionally, consider color coordination when combining different patterns. Opt for patterns that share a common color to tie the outfit together seamlessly.

Mixing Textures for Depth

Adding a mix of textures to your outfit can create depth and visual interest, elevating your overall look to new levels of sophistication. When mixing textures, consider pairing a chunky knit sweater with sleek leather leggings or a velvet dress with sheer tights. The contrast between rough and smooth textures adds dimension to your outfit and makes it more visually appealing.

To create a cohesive look, balance heavier textures with lighter ones. For example, pair a fuzzy sweater with opaque tights or a sequined skirt with a silky blouse. Mixing textures not only adds depth but also creates a tactile experience, making your outfit more engaging.

Experiment with different combinations to find what works best for you. Don't be afraid to mix unexpected textures like lace with denim or suede with silk.
